Caftaric acid is a naturally occurring hydroxycinnamic acid derivative belonging to the class of phenolic compounds, widely recognized for its significant presence in grapes and wine. Chemically characterized by the molecular formula C10H8O6 and assigned the CAS number 2579-32-4, this compound features a caffeoyl moiety esterified with tartaric acid, granting it unique stability and reactivity profiles essential for its biological functions. As a primary precursor in the biosynthesis of various polyphenols, caftaric acid plays a pivotal role in the antioxidant defense mechanisms of plants, particularly within the Vitis vinifera species.
In the food and beverage industry, caftaric acid is of paramount importance due to its direct impact on wine quality and color stability. During winemaking, enzymatic oxidation of this compound by polyphenol oxidase can lead to the formation of o-quinones, which subsequently polymerize into brown pigments, causing undesirable browning in white wines. Consequently, understanding and managing caftaric acid levels is critical for winemakers aiming to preserve the fresh, fruity character and clarity of their products. Beyond enology, the compound exhibits potent antioxidant properties, effectively scavenging free radicals and reducing oxidative stress in biological systems. This makes it a subject of intense interest in nutritional science and pharmaceutical research, where it is investigated for potential cardioprotective, anti-inflammatory, and anticancer effects.
Furthermore, caftaric acid serves as a valuable biomarker in metabolomic studies, helping researchers trace dietary intake of fruits and assess the health benefits associated with grape consumption. Its presence is also monitored in agricultural contexts to evaluate the ripening stage of berries and the efficacy of viticultural practices. While not typically sold as a standalone consumer product, high-purity caftaric acid is increasingly utilized in laboratory settings for standardizing analytical methods and developing functional food ingredients or nutraceutical supplements designed to enhance human health through natural phenolic enrichment.
